Typically, when car wax is applied to the car and buffed, it creates a shine that is permeable. The new waxes that have been created using nanotechnology seep down into invisible holes in the body of the car. The particles in the nanotechnology wax are so small that they allow the wax to penetrate the miniscule holes in the body of the car. Therefore, scratches and minor dings can simply be wiped away.
